Skip to main content

2018 | OriginalPaper | Buchkapitel

Reaction Mining for Reaction Systems

verfasst von : Artur Męski, Maciej Koutny, Wojciech Penczek

Erschienen in: Unconventional Computation and Natural Computation

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

Reaction systems are a formal model for specifying and analysing computational processes in which reactions operate on sets of entities (molecules), providing a framework for dealing with qualitative aspects of biochemical systems. This paper is concerned with reaction systems in which entities can have discrete concentrations and reactions operate on multisets of entities, providing a succinct framework for dealing with quantitative aspects of systems. This is facilitated by a dedicated linear-time temporal logic which allows one to express and verify a wide range of behavioural system properties.
In practical applications, a reaction system with discrete concentrations may only be partially specified, and effective calculation of the missing details would provide an attractive design approach. To develop such an approach, this paper introduces reaction systems with parameters representing the unknown parts of the reactions. The main result is a method which attempts to replace these parameters in such a way that the resulting reaction system operating in a given external environment satisfies a given temporal logic formula. We provide a suitable encoding of parametric reaction systems in smt, and outline a synthesis procedure based on bounded model checking for solving the synthesis problem. We also provide preliminary experimental results demonstrating the feasibility of the new synthesis method.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Fußnoten
1
The experimental results were obtained using a system equipped with 3.7 GHz Intel Xeon (E5-1620 v2) processor and 12 GB of memory, running Mac OS X 10.13.2.
 
Literatur
2.
Zurück zum Zitat Azimi, S., Gratie, C., Ivanov, S., Manzoni, L., Petre, I., Porreca, A.E.: Complexity of model checking for reaction systems. Theor. Comput. Sci. 623, 103–113 (2016)MathSciNetCrossRef Azimi, S., Gratie, C., Ivanov, S., Manzoni, L., Petre, I., Porreca, A.E.: Complexity of model checking for reaction systems. Theor. Comput. Sci. 623, 103–113 (2016)MathSciNetCrossRef
3.
Zurück zum Zitat Azimi, S., Gratie, C., Ivanov, S., Petre, I.: Dependency graphs and mass conservation in reaction systems. Theor. Comput. Sci. 598, 23–39 (2015)MathSciNetCrossRef Azimi, S., Gratie, C., Ivanov, S., Petre, I.: Dependency graphs and mass conservation in reaction systems. Theor. Comput. Sci. 598, 23–39 (2015)MathSciNetCrossRef
4.
Zurück zum Zitat Azimi, S., Iancu, B., Petre, I.: Reaction system models for the heat shock response. Fundamenta Informaticae 131(3–4), 299–312 (2014)MathSciNetMATH Azimi, S., Iancu, B., Petre, I.: Reaction system models for the heat shock response. Fundamenta Informaticae 131(3–4), 299–312 (2014)MathSciNetMATH
6.
Zurück zum Zitat Corolli, L., Maj, C., Marini, F., Besozzi, D., Mauri, G.: An excursion in reaction systems: from computer science to biology. Theor. Comput. Sci. 454, 95–108 (2012)MathSciNetCrossRef Corolli, L., Maj, C., Marini, F., Besozzi, D., Mauri, G.: An excursion in reaction systems: from computer science to biology. Theor. Comput. Sci. 454, 95–108 (2012)MathSciNetCrossRef
7.
Zurück zum Zitat Dennunzio, A., Formenti, E., Manzoni, L.: Reaction systems and extremal combinatorics properties. Theor. Comput. Sci. 598, 138–149 (2015)MathSciNetCrossRef Dennunzio, A., Formenti, E., Manzoni, L.: Reaction systems and extremal combinatorics properties. Theor. Comput. Sci. 598, 138–149 (2015)MathSciNetCrossRef
8.
Zurück zum Zitat Dennunzio, A., Formenti, E., Manzoni, L., Porreca, A.E.: Ancestors, descendants, and gardens of eden in reaction systems. Theor. Comput. Sci. 608, 16–26 (2015)MathSciNetCrossRef Dennunzio, A., Formenti, E., Manzoni, L., Porreca, A.E.: Ancestors, descendants, and gardens of eden in reaction systems. Theor. Comput. Sci. 608, 16–26 (2015)MathSciNetCrossRef
9.
Zurück zum Zitat Ehrenfeucht, A., Kleijn, J., Koutny, M., Rozenberg, G.: Reaction systems: a natural computing approach to the functioning of living cells. In: A Computable Universe, Understanding and Exploring Nature as Computation, pp. 189–208 (2012)CrossRef Ehrenfeucht, A., Kleijn, J., Koutny, M., Rozenberg, G.: Reaction systems: a natural computing approach to the functioning of living cells. In: A Computable Universe, Understanding and Exploring Nature as Computation, pp. 189–208 (2012)CrossRef
10.
Zurück zum Zitat Ehrenfeucht, A., Kleijn, J., Koutny, M., Rozenberg, G.: Evolving reaction systems. Theor. Comput. Sci. 682, 79–99 (2017)MathSciNetCrossRef Ehrenfeucht, A., Kleijn, J., Koutny, M., Rozenberg, G.: Evolving reaction systems. Theor. Comput. Sci. 682, 79–99 (2017)MathSciNetCrossRef
11.
Zurück zum Zitat Ehrenfeucht, A., Rozenberg, G.: Reaction systems. Fundamenta Informaticae 75(1–4), 263–280 (2007)MathSciNetMATH Ehrenfeucht, A., Rozenberg, G.: Reaction systems. Fundamenta Informaticae 75(1–4), 263–280 (2007)MathSciNetMATH
12.
Zurück zum Zitat Ehrenfeucht, A., Rozenberg, G.: Introducing time in reaction systems. Theor. Comput. Sci. 410(4–5), 310–322 (2009)MathSciNetCrossRef Ehrenfeucht, A., Rozenberg, G.: Introducing time in reaction systems. Theor. Comput. Sci. 410(4–5), 310–322 (2009)MathSciNetCrossRef
15.
Zurück zum Zitat Formenti, E., Manzoni, L., Porreca, A.E.: On the complexity of occurrence and convergence problems in reaction systems. Nat. Comput. 14, 1–7 (2014)MathSciNetCrossRef Formenti, E., Manzoni, L., Porreca, A.E.: On the complexity of occurrence and convergence problems in reaction systems. Nat. Comput. 14, 1–7 (2014)MathSciNetCrossRef
16.
17.
20.
Zurück zum Zitat Męski, A., Penczek, W., Rozenberg, G.: Model checking temporal properties of reaction systems. Inf. Sci. 313, 22–42 (2015)CrossRef Męski, A., Penczek, W., Rozenberg, G.: Model checking temporal properties of reaction systems. Inf. Sci. 313, 22–42 (2015)CrossRef
22.
Zurück zum Zitat Męski, A., Koutny, M., Penczek, W.: Verification of linear-time temporal properties for reaction systems with discrete concentrations. Fundam. Inform. 154(1–4), 289–306 (2017)MathSciNetCrossRef Męski, A., Koutny, M., Penczek, W.: Verification of linear-time temporal properties for reaction systems with discrete concentrations. Fundam. Inform. 154(1–4), 289–306 (2017)MathSciNetCrossRef
23.
25.
Zurück zum Zitat Salomaa, A.: Functional constructions between reaction systems and propositional logic. Int. J. Found. Comput. Sci. 24(1), 147–160 (2013)MathSciNetCrossRef Salomaa, A.: Functional constructions between reaction systems and propositional logic. Int. J. Found. Comput. Sci. 24(1), 147–160 (2013)MathSciNetCrossRef
Metadaten
Titel
Reaction Mining for Reaction Systems
verfasst von
Artur Męski
Maciej Koutny
Wojciech Penczek
Copyright-Jahr
2018
DOI
https://doi.org/10.1007/978-3-319-92435-9_10

Premium Partner